Benefits That Go Beyond the Battery 

Vehicle solar systems don’t just reduce fuel costs. They also power onboard systems while your vehicles are idle, helping extend battery life, reduce downtime, and lower emissions.

Imagine a truck powering its liftgate or refrigeration unit while parked, without burning a drop of diesel. Or a bus running air systems, lighting, or ticketing systems without needing to idle. It’s not just fuel savings. It’s total system efficiency.

When integrated with energy storage, these systems help make fleets more resilient, storing solar power for use when and where it’s needed most.

Flexible Car Solar Panels for All Shapes and Sizes 

Unlike traditional rigid panels, newer vehicle solar systems use flexible car solar panels for heavy vehicle applications, especially where flat roof space is limited or uneven.

From box trucks to long-haul trailers to custom-built RVs, these modules conform to design without compromising performance. The panels weigh just a few kilograms and are rugged enough to withstand the shocks of the road.

This flexibility and weight advantage are crucial for modern photovoltaic systems on the move.
